Transaction 3bd3fe1ec16ce93d785f33ad988a27e5bc11e4fe314f9fa90b64a30abaf82814

1 Input
2 Outputs
  • 3bd3fe1ec16ce93d785f33ad988a27e5bc11e4fe314f9fa90b64a30abaf82814:0
  • value  1020319276
    address  19tHTQQeXfppCznBrtWjiGvtiTuA9EDJPe
  • 3bd3fe1ec16ce93d785f33ad988a27e5bc11e4fe314f9fa90b64a30abaf82814:1
  • value  2380840000
    address  3MkK5GK7GVTdW4EuKGwfKTNxHQhEmvRWor